Q10.
ActiveX control cannot be downloaded. How can I do this?
a.
IE browser may block the ActiveX control. Please do setup as per the steps mentioned below.
① Open IE browser. Click
② Select Security→Custom Level. Refer to Fig 10-1.
③ Enable all the sub options under "ActiveX controls and plug-ins". Refer to Fig 10-2.
④ Then click "OK" to finish setup.
b.
Other plug-ins or anti-virus may block ActiveX. Please disable or do the required settings.
Q11.
How do I play a backup file?
a.
Recording backed up by NVR: insert the USB device with the recorded backup files unto the USB interface of a PC, and then open the USB device
path. The recording can be backed up in either the private format or AVI format by the NVR.
If you select the private format when backing up an NVR recording, an RPAS (Recording Player Application Software) compression package will
be backed up to the USB device automatically along with the record data. Uncompress the "RPAS.zip" and then click "RPAS.exe" to set up RPAS. After
the setup is completed, open RPAS player and then click "Open Folder" button in the middle of the interface to select the record data. Refer to Fig
11-1.
Select camera in the resource tree on the left side of the interface to play the camera recording. Click
to enable audio. Refer to Fig 11-2.
